Output 61058152a74df1683d278f2629a64f6f12958d620407145edab7a574f702e08d:0

value
109000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21cc5e93b70f37a4c85e39a6dfc7309d4aee8c5a OP_EQUALVERIFY OP_CHECKSIG
address
145i8AkcLAJXP8kXby3dg9qjZ2YGF86vXZ
transaction
61058152a74df1683d278f2629a64f6f12958d620407145edab7a574f702e08d
spent
true